APPROACH
Craft Home is a registered company working to strengthen the handicrafts ecosystem by supporting artisans and creative practitioners at different stages of their journey. The platform provides access to raw materials, skills development, and shared production infrastructure, with a focus on market-oriented learning and the sustainable growth of small and medium-sized craft-based enterprises.
